About the job Transaction Services Manager
Are you an experienced and ambitious Transaction Services Manager looking to join a growing boutique advisory firm?
We are looking for a highly motivated individual to lead and execute financial due diligence and transaction support engagements for our clients.
As a Transaction Services Manager, you will be responsible for reviewing financial, operational, and commercial aspects of potential acquisitions, identifying and assessing risks and opportunities, and providing insightful recommendations to clients on transaction structure and pricing.
You'll work closely with clients and their advisors to provide pre- and post-deal analysis, financial modelling, and integration planning, while developing and maintaining strong client relationships and assisting in business development initiatives.
To be successful in this role, you should have a Bachelor's degree in finance, accounting, or a related field, with at least 5 years of experience in financial due diligence, transaction services, or corporate finance.
You should possess strong technical skills in financial modelling and data analysis, excellent communication, interpersonal and project management skills, and strong leadership skills to manage a team of professionals.
The ability to work effectively under tight deadlines and in a fast-paced environment is essential.
